## Step 4: Update Canary Gating Rules

Gatewick 7 replaces the old pass/fail canary check with weighted gates. Plugins must emit a verdict per gate; the controller aggregates. Remove any calls to the legacy verdict hook — it's gone. Error-rate and latency gates now block by default; custom gates advise only unless flagged. Verify your plugin against a staging controller first. The default gating configuration ships as follows.

config for kagup-hahig:
druwyn:
  pin: 2801
  metrics_host: metrics.druwyn.zemvarlabs.internal
  tenant: sorius
  seal: seal_798a43d7

Ticket: Configuration drift detected on the Maplight tile-rendering cache layer. The staging and production nodes in the Veldham cluster are serving tiles with different eviction windows, which explains the inconsistent map refresh reports from last week. Support should not manually flush caches until the drift is reconciled; doing so resets the warm set and makes load spikes worse. A remediation job is scheduled for the next maintenance window. The expected configuration values for the cache layer follow below.

settings of tajep-tafog:
CASDOR_LOG_LEVEL=info
CASDOR_METRICS_HOST=metrics.casdor.nelvrosys.internal
CASDOR_POOL_SIZE=16

Key ceremony checklist — item 7 (SQLGuard linting setup)

Welcome aboard! Before the ceremony, make sure the SQLGuard lint rules repo is checked out and passing locally — yes, even the picky uppercase-keyword and no-select-star rules, since the ceremony scripts are plain .sql files and the signing pipeline refuses anything that fails lint. Run the full rule set twice; flaky caching is a known thing. Once lint is green, unlock the ceremony keybox with the recovery passphrase:

unlock words, hahip-baduf: holwyn-istath-julvan